My wife got her best buck yet (2nd ever). We spooked him and a doe at 200 yards while we were sneaking over the hill to set up. They took off but the buck was too worried about the doe to care about us.

He ran her in a loop and they stopped at 286 yards. My wife was prone watching through the scope. I fed her the range to adjust her hold as the buck turned broadside behind the doe. I gave a wind call and told her to let it fly. Right then the buck mounted the doe, and I was just starting to say "Hold -" BOOM!

The buck tipped over sideways off the doe into the dirt and never moved, and the doe raced off. One of the craziest things I've ever seen. After throwing up a quick prayer of thanks that things went as they did, I said, "I was about to say 'Hold off a minute', to which she replied, "Oh, I was rock solid, and I knew he wasn't going anywhere."

Sure enough his heart was in 2 pieces when we opened him up. My wife is a dead eye shooter on game, and she proved it again, even though I'd prefer a little bigger window for error in the future. 😅

I've shot 100 grains of triple 7 under a 385 great plains bullet for years. With the lighter bullet I bumped up the powder charge. A lot of people run 90-120 grains depending on the bullet. You just have to see what shoots best in your muzzleloader. The 297 Thor over 120 grains was just under 1800 fps.
